SheilaHammond · 26/05/2019 17:49

I don’t but DB does. Yes he has annual eye checks (free, cos it’s necessary), and also had some laser surgery after a while. All under control now and he’s v active and sporty, mountain biking etc. Day to day it’s no bother.

My children and I get checked annually too as there is some genetic component. So far we are unaffected. AFAIK if it’s discovered early it’s no problem and just needs managing.
